Responsibilities

Develop and maintain embedded firmware for power-related products.Design firmware for power conversion control, battery charging/discharging strategies, and relay/sensor management.Work closely with hardware teams and ODM partners to ensure system-level integration and reliability.Collaborate cross-functionally with BSP, HW, ID, Backend, Mobile, FE, PM and PA team  to deliver high-quality products.Collaborate with cross-functional teams in product planning and development.Collaborate with hardware, systems, and validation teams to define specifications and ensure seamless integration.Document firmware design, manage source code (e.g., with Git), and participate in system testing and QA.Perform code reviews, ensuring best practices in coding standards.Participate in troubleshooting and root-cause analysis for firmware issues.
 Requirement Proficient in C/C++ development for embedded systems, including experience with bare-metal or RTOS-based firmware (e.g., FreeRTOS).Able to read schematics and work directly with hardware during bring-up/debug phases.Basic knowledge of power system safety and reliability considerations.Solid understanding of power electronics and battery management concepts (e.g., SOC/SOH monitoring, cell balancing, overcurrent/overvoltage protection).Conduct debugging and validation using tools such as o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, and JTAG debuggers.Experience with battery charging control (DC/DC converters) and inverter control logic (DC/AC).Hands-on experience with ESP32 or similar MCU platforms.Familiarity with Git version control.A genuine passion for embedded software development.A team player, who is very self-motivated, loves difficult challenges, and is goal driven.Strong communication skills, able to work both solo and in teams.
Preferred QualificationsDeep knowledge and hands-on experience with UPS architecture including rectifier, inverter, and bypass control.Experience with EMI/EMC considerations in firmware design.Experience with Battery Management Systems (BMS).Exposure to MATLAB/Simulink for modeling and control algorithm prototyping.Familiarity with digital signal processing, control theory, and implementation of PID and other control algorithms.Experience with digital PFC (Power Factor Correction) control (AC to DC) is a plusExperience developing firmware for MCU/DSP platforms used in power electronics applications.Experience with network stack implementation and communication protocols over TCP/IP.Knowledge of safety and regulatory standards relevant to power systems (UL, IEC, etc.).Expertise in low‑power, dynamic voltage/frequency scaling, and battery management.Proven experience integrating firmware with Linux‑based SoC platformsSkilled at defining and implementing custom communication protocols for heterogeneous systems.Experience with OTA updates, secure boot, and embedded security mechanisms.
